What is the value of s in the equation 3r = 10 + 5s, when r = 10?

Respuesta :

Pinozombie Pinozombie
  • 02-04-2018

S=4.  if r=10 than it would be 3(10)= 10+5s.

30=10+5s

20=5s

s=4
